WinSCP 6.5



WinSCP is an open source free SFTP client, FTP client, WebDAV client and SCP client for Windows. Its main function is file transfer between a local and a remote computer. Beyond this, WinSCP offers scripting and basic file manager functionality.

WinSCP features:

  • Graphical user interface
  • Translated into several languages
  • Integration with Windows (drag&drop, URL, shortcut icons)
  • U3 support
  • All common operations with files
  • Support for SFTP and SCP protocols over SSH-1 and SSH-2 and plain old FTP protocol
  • Batch file scripting and command-line interface
  • Directory synchronization in several semi or fully automatic ways
  • Integrated text editor
  • Support for SSH password, keyboard-interactive, public key and Kerberos (GSS) authentication
  • Integrates with Pageant (PuTTY authentication agent) for full support of public key authentication with SSH
  • Explorer and Commander interfaces
  • Optionally stores session information
  • Optionally supports portable operation using a configuration file in place of registry entries, suitable for operation from removable media

WinSCP 6.5 changelog:

  • Thumbnail view in file panels.
  • Three selectable sizes of toolbar icons, showing slightly larger size by default.
  • Switching to Segoe UI font with slightly larger size.
  • Improvements to Synchronization checklist window, including resolving file moves and pushing synchronization to background queue.
  • Ongoing local delete operation can be moved to a background queue.
  • Optimized working with large local directories.
  • Compatibility with new OneDrive WebDAV interface.
  • Dark theme for session tabs.
  • Improvements to S3 support, including more options to authentication and display and modification of S3 file/object tags.
